NOTICE OF MAKING OF PUBLIC PATH DIVERSION AND DEFINITIVE MAP AND STATEMENT MODIFICATION ORDER

HIGHWAYS ACT 1980 AND WILDLIFE AND COUNTRYSIDE ACT 1981

WILTSHIRE COUNCIL

THE WILTSHIRE COUNCIL PARISH OF RAMSBURY PATH Nos. 5, 6 AND 8C AND PARISH OF LITTLE BEDWYN PATH NO.20 DIVERSION AND DEFINITIVE MAP AND STATEMENT MODIFICATION ORDER 2025

The above named Order, made on 25th July 2025, under section 119 of the Highways Act 1980 and section 53 of the Wildlife and Countryside Act 1981, will divert the public rights of way over the land situate at Park Farm, Ramsbury, SN8 2HW. That entire width and length of that public right of way (bridleway), leading from OS Grid Reference SU 25971 69301, in a north westerly direction for approximately 625 metres to OS Grid Reference SU 25556 69768 then north easterly for approximately 260 metres to SU 25694 69991, known as bridleway Ramsbury path no.6, will be diverted to a new route leading from OS Grid Reference SU 25971 69301, in a broadly north easterly, then north westerly direction for a total of approximately 704 metres to OS Grid Reference SU 25734 70066, having a width of 4 metres. Three sets of lockable vehicle restricting bollards will be installed on this route at SU 25984 69326, SU 26078 69882 and SU 25748 70064 with a minimum 1.5 metre spacing between the bollards. The new route will be recorded as a bridleway. Also, the entire width and length of that public right of way (footpath) leading, from OS Grid Reference SU 25556 69768, in a broadly north westerly direction for approximately 210 metres to OS Grid Reference SU 25373 69870, known as footpath Ramsbury path no. 8C, will be diverted to a route leading from OS Grid Reference SU 25373 69870 in a broadly north easterly direction for approximately 340 metres to OS Grid Reference SU 25694 69991, having a width of 2 metres. Two new kissing gates will be installed on this route to BS standard BS5709 at SU 25694 69991 and SU 25466 69906. The new route will be recorded as a footpath. Also, the entire width and length of that public right of way (footpath) leading from just south of the parish boundary between Little Bedwyn and Ramsbury at OS Grid Reference SU 24823 68283, in a broadly westerly direction for approximately 210 metres to OS Grid reference SU 24628 68237 then turning in a broadly north easterly direction for approximately 180 metres to OS Grid Reference SU 24688 68492, known as footpaths Little Bedwyn no.20 and Ramsbury no.5, will be diverted to a new route leading from OS Grid Reference SU 24823 68283 in a broadly north westerly direction for approximately 250 metres to OS Grid Reference SU 24688 68492, having a width of 2 metres. This new route will be subject to a kissing gate to BS standard BS5709 at SU 24787 68342. The new route will be recorded as a footpath. Copies of the Order and Order Schedule and Order Map may be seen at the Marlborough and Ramsbury Rural District Council offices and online at www.wiltshire.gov.uk, or may be obtained free of charge at the address below.

Any representation or objection relating to the order must be sent in writing to Craig Harlow, Definitive Map and Highway Records, Wiltshire Council, Bythesea Road, Trowbridge, BA14 8JN or by email to craig.harlow@wiltshire.gov.uk quoting the title of the Order “The Wiltshire Council parish of Ramsbury Path Nos. 5,6 and 8C and parish of Little Bedwyn Path No.20 diversion and definitive map and statement modification order 2025”, not later than 17:00 on 5th September 2025 and respondents are requested to state the grounds on which it is made. If no such representations or objections are duly made, or if any so made are withdrawn, Wiltshire Council may confirm the Order as an unopposed Order. If the Order is sent to the Secretary of State for the Environment, Food and Rural Affairs for confirmation any representations or objections which have not been withdrawn will be sent with the Order. NOTICE OF MODIFICATION ORDER SECTION 53 OF THE WILDLIFE AND COUNTRYSIDE ACT 1981

WILTSHIRE COUNCIL

THE DEFINITIVE MAP AND STATEMENT FOR THE PEWSEY RURAL DISTRICT COUNCIL AREA DATED 1952 AS MODIFIED UNDER THE PROVISIONS OF THE WILDLIFE AND COUNTRYSIDE ACT 1981

THE WILTSHIRE COUNCIL PARISH OF WILCOT AND HUSH WITH OARE PATH NO. 32A DEFINITIVE MAP AND STATEMENT MODIFICATION ORDER 2025

The above order, made on 29th July 2025, if confirmed as made, will modify the definitive map and statement for the area by adding a public footpath in the parish of Wilcot and Huish with Oare leading from its eastern junction with footpath WILC32 and WILC34 at OS grid reference SU 13852 60522 leading broadly west along the existing track for approximately 446 metres to its junction with bridleway WILC33 at SU 13935 60506 at Cocklebury Farm. The path will have a recorded width of 4 metres, centred on the middle point of the track. The recorded width limited to 1.4 metres around the north east point of the bend in situ at SU 13321 60553, between the gate post and the post and rail fence. A copy of the order and map may be seen free of charge at the Definitive Map and Highway Records, Wiltshire Council, County Hall, Trowbridge, BA14 8JN, 0900 - 1700 weekdays by appointment or an appointment please email definitiveimap@wiltshire.gov.uk or call 01249 468658. Electronic copies may also be requested by emailing craig.harlow@wiltshire.gov.uk. Any representation or objection relating to this order must be sent in writing to Craig Harlow, Definitive Map Officer, Definitive Map and Highway Records, Wiltshire Council, Bythesea Road, Trowbridge, BA14 8JN or by email at craig.harlow@wiltshire.gov.uk, quoting the title of the order, “The Wiltshire Council parish of Wilcot and Huish with Oare Path No.32A Definitive Map and Statement Modification Order 2025”, not later than 17:00 on 5th September 2025, and respondents are requested to state the grounds on which it is made.

If no representations or objections are duly made, or if any so made are withdrawn, the Wiltshire Council, instead of submitting the order to the Secretary of State (or part of it if the authority has by notice to the Secretary of State so elected under paragraph 5 of Schedule 15 to the Wildlife and Countryside Act 1981) may itself confirm the order (or that part of the order). If the order is submitted to the Secretary of State for the Environment, in whole or in part, any representations or objections which have been duly made and not withdrawn will be sent with it.
